Loose/leaking fuel line in the tank, or maybe the pump section carb diaphragm/gasket installed in wrong order.
Must be in the fuel line cause the carb kit was put in right.

Are you sure? The pump diaphragm should be the last thing on (with the carb body upside down) before you put the pump cover on. I put one together wrong once. Ran, but wouldn't pump fuel for ####...
